The LAS 28 XLe laser marking system from Systemtechnik Hölzer GmbH is a universally applicable, high-performance marking solution designed for industrial applications. It is suitable for precise and permanent marking of a wide range of materials including metals such as steel, aluminum, and hard metals, as well as plastics. The integration of a fiber laser ensures high marking quality while keeping maintenance requirements to a minimum.
The system can be configured with fiber lasers in power classes of 20 W, 30 W, or 50 W, enabling optimal adaptation to different requirements concerning material type, marking depth, and cycle time. In many industrial sectors, the use of this technology is indispensable due to the durability and abrasion resistance of the markings.

The included laser software allows the creation and positioning of content such as texts, numbering, 2D codes (e.g., DataMatrix), QR codes, and logos. Automatic serialization logic enables the generation of consecutive serial numbers without manual intervention. Additionally, the software supports importing and processing of external data sources (e.g., Excel spreadsheets) for variable contents like drawing numbers or project names. Integration of a hand scanner for data capture is optionally available.
By default, the LAS 28 XLe is delivered with an integrated industrial PC (Windows-based) and fully installed laser software. Various options are available to expand its functionality, including a rotary axis (3-jaw chuck) for marking cylindrical components, side arms for processing long parts, a motorized Z-axis, and modular drawer systems for part feeding.
